2014-02-18Avoid returning original macro if expansion fails.Douglas Young-1/+1
Closes #11692. Instead of returning the original expression, a dummy expression (with identical span) is returned. This prevents infinite loops of failed expansions as well as odd double error messages in certain situations.

2014-01-18syntax::ext: replace span_fatal with span_err in many places.Huon Wilson-1/+4
This means that compilation continues for longer, and so we can see more errors per compile. This is mildly more user-friendly because it stops users having to run rustc n times to see n macro errors: just run it once to see all of them.

2013-10-08add new enum ast::StrStyle as field to ast::lit_strBenjamin Herr-1/+1
For the benefit of the pretty printer we want to keep track of how string literals in the ast were originally represented in the source code. This commit changes parser functions so they don't extract strings from the token stream without at least also returning what style of string literal it was. This is stored in the resulting ast node for string literals, obviously, for the package id in `extern mod = r"package id"` view items, for the inline asm in `asm!()` invocations. For `asm!()`'s other arguments or for `extern "Rust" fn()` items, I just the style of string, because it seemed disproportionally cumbersome to thread that information through the string processing that happens with those string literals, given the limited advantage raw string literals would provide in these positions. The other syntax extensions don't seem to store passed string literals in the ast, so they also discard the style of strings they parse.
2013-09-16Limit spans in bytes!() error messages to the argument in questionKevin Ballard-10/+10
This constrains the span to the appropriate argument, so you know which one caused the problem. Instead of foo.rs:2:4: 2:21 error: Too large integer literal in bytes! foo.rs:2 bytes!(1, 256, 2) 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 it will say foo.rs:2:14 2:17 error: Too large integer literal in bytes! foo.rs:2 bytes!(1, 256, 2) ^~~
